Hola me da un error al abrir el programa Pitivi en Ubuntu Feisty Fawn2 el
problema es el siguiente:


pillo at jump:~$ pitivi
/usr/lib/python2.4/site-packages/cairo/__init__.py:1: RuntimeWarning: Python C
API version mismatch for module cairo._cairo: This Python has API version 1013,
module cairo._cairo has version 1012.
  from _cairo import *
/usr/lib/python2.4/site-packages/gst-0.10/gst/__init__.py:108: RuntimeWarning:
Python C API version mismatch for module _gst: This Python has API version
1013, module _gst has version 1012.
  from _gst import *
/usr/lib/python2.4/site-packages/gst-0.10/gst/__init__.py:109: RuntimeWarning:
Python C API version mismatch for module interfaces: This Python has API
version 1013, module interfaces has version 1012.
  import interfaces
The program 'pitivi' received an X Window System error.
This probably reflects a bug in the program.
The error was 'BadWindow (invalid Window parameter)'.
  (Details: serial 38 error_code 3 request_code 3 minor_code 0)
  (Note to programmers: normally, X errors are reported asynchronously;
   that is, you will receive the error a while after causing it.
   To debug your program, run it with the --sync command line
   option to change this behavior. You can then get a meaningful
   backtrace from your debugger if you break on the gdk_x_error() function.)
